Macaulay Culkin was the first child in Hollywood to make $1 million (€733,353) for a single movie, but he famously lost the bulk of his estate in the bitter custody trial between his father Kit and his mother Patricia Brentrup. Kit is now dying, according to new reports, and the two never reconciled.

TMZ reports that Kit, who is 69 and has not spoken to his famous son since the ‘90s, is now in a hospital in Oregon, after having been rushed there for a “massive” stroke. He is in intensive care, surrounded by friends and family, but doctors are not very optimistic about his condition.

“[He] has lost almost all of his motor functions and the prognosis is not good. Sources tell us family members have been summoned to the hospital,” TMZ writes.

In a separate post, the same media outlet claims to have it on good authority that, before the stroke, Kit had desperately tried to get in touch with Macaulay to mend the broken bridges between them. He wanted the feud to be over and, says the e-zine, he may now never have the chance to do that.

“Kit told family members he wanted to repair his relationship with Mac. […] We're told Kit was trying to get Macaulay's number – telling family members to pass the word on to his son – but they never connected,” the report notes.

It doesn’t say why Kit would have waited so long before even thinking of taking appropriate action to make things alright with his son again, but it does say that Macaulay has been on the road a lot in recent months and, because of it, has not been in touch with most of his family.
